The heavyweight boxing division remains one of the most exciting and dynamic categories in combat sports, constantly shifting with new challenges, unified titles, and the rise of formidable contenders. As of mid-2025, the landscape is dominated by a few undisputed talents and a strong cohort of elite contenders vying for supremacy.
Here is a look at the top 10 heavyweight boxers in the world right now, based on a consensus from various official rankings:
Top 10 Heavyweight Boxers
1. Oleksandr Usyk (23-0-0, 14 KOs)
The undisputed heavyweight champion, Usyk consistently holds the top spot across all major ranking bodies, including Heavyweight Boxing, Boxingtalk, The Ring, WBA, WBC, and WBO . His undefeated record and technical mastery make him the clear king of the division .
2. Daniel Dubois (22-2-0, 21 KOs)
Holding the IBF World Title, Dubois is a formidable force in the heavyweight division . He is ranked second by Heavyweight Boxing and Boxingtalk, and third by Split Decision, showcasing his strong position .
3. Tyson Fury (33-0-1)
Despite recent results, Fury remains a top contender, ranked first by Split Decision and third by Boxingtalk . The Ring considers him the #1 contender behind the champion, further solidifying his elite status .
4. Joseph Parker (36-3-0)
As the WBO interim champion, Parker’s stock has risen significantly . Split Decision ranks him third, and he appears prominently in the top five of various other lists, including BoxRec and The Ring .
5. Anthony Joshua
Joshua consistently features in the top tier of heavyweight rankings. He is BoxRec’s #1 contender and holds high positions with the WBC and The Ring .
6. Zhilei Zhang
Known for his power, Zhang is a consistent presence in the top 10 . Boxingtalk ranks him fifth, and he appears in the top five of the WBO rankings .
7. Agit Kabayel (23-0-0)
An undefeated fighter, Kabayel is ranked fourth by Split Decision and holds the WBC interim title . His unblemished record makes him a significant threat in the division.
8. Martin Bakole
Bakole is frequently listed within the top 10 by several ranking bodies, including Boxingtalk and various sanctioning bodies .
9. Filip Hrgovic
Consistently appearing in the top 10 across multiple lists, Hrgovic is a well-regarded contender. He is ranked within the top seven by BoxRec, The Ring, and the IBF .
10. Moses Itauma
A rising star, Itauma is ranked as the #1 WBO contender and #3 by the WBA, indicating his rapid ascent in the division .
